Bunge Global Q1 Net Income Declines

Bunge Global SA (BG) has reported a decrease in first quarter net income attributed to Bunge, falling to $244 million from last year's $632 million. The net income per share also saw a decline, dropping from $4.15 to $1.68. Despite adjusting the net income per share, it also fell to $3.04 from $3.26. A poll conducted by Thomson Reuters, in which 11 analysts participated, anticipated the company's profit per share for this quarter to hit $2.53. Special items are usually excluded in the analysts' estimates.

The company's first quarter net sales also declined as compared to last year, amounting to $13.42 billion as opposed to the $15.33 billion recorded in the same period last year. The average revenue estimate predicted by analysts was $13.96 billion.

Moreover, Bunge Global SA (BG) is holding steady on its adjusted full-year earnings per share (EPS) forecast, at approximately $9.00. Following the same trend, analysts are expecting the company's profit per share to reach $9.39.

On a final note, Bunge Global shares dipped by 2% in Wednesday's pre-market trade.
